

· By Gabby Yan
Java Island, Indonesia: The Soul of the Archipelago
Key Takeaways
-
Java is Indonesia’s cultural and political heart, home to 150+ million people and major cities like Jakarta and Yogyakarta.
-
It offers a rich mix of history, nature, and urban energy from ancient temples like Borobudur to smoking volcanoes like Bromo and Ijen.
-
Top experiences include sunrise hikes, street food feasts, train travel, and local crafts like batik.
-
It’s budget-friendly, well-connected, and perfect for travelers who want both chaos and calm.
-
For a deeper connection, stay local, travel slow, and embrace the contrast. Java rewards curiosity.
Java isn’t just the name of your morning coffee. It’s the beating heart of Indonesia, an island home to over 150 million people, making it the most populated island on Earth. Yes, you read that right. One island. 150 million people. That’s like squeezing half of the U.S. population into an area the size of North Carolina. But don’t let the numbers intimidate you. Java isn’t just crowded streets and bustling cities (though Jakarta’s traffic could win an award). It’s a living mosaic of ancient temples, smoldering volcanoes, lush tea plantations, and cities pulsing with history and charm.
This island is where you’ll watch the sun rise over Mount Bromo, casting an otherworldly glow over the sea of sand. It’s where the majestic Borobudur Temple, older than Angkor Wat, stands quietly under the tropical sky, telling stories carved in stone. One moment, you’re sipping kopi luwak in a Yogyakarta café, and the next, you’re chasing waterfalls tucked behind emerald-green rice terraces. Java is Indonesia’s best-kept not-so-secret, balancing the chaos of urban life with the tranquility of nature. Ready to dive in? Let’s unravel the magic of Java, one adventure at a time.
Quick Facts About Java Island
Let’s start with the basics. Java isn’t just another dot on the map of Indonesia. It’s the dot. This island is around 138,800 square kilometers (about the size of Greece), packed with 150 million people. That’s not just busy; that’s next-level bustling. Java holds more than half of Indonesia’s population, yet somehow still finds room for sprawling rice terraces, active volcanoes, and sleepy villages.
Major Cities? Jakarta (the capital city that never sleeps, unless it’s stuck in traffic), Yogyakarta (the artsy, cultural heartbeat), Surabaya (a dynamic port city), and Bandung (for those who love cooler weather and hipster coffee spots).
Language? Bahasa Indonesia, but smiles are universal.
Climate? Tropical, baby. Expect hot, humid days, with a wet season (November-March) and a dry season (April-October). Pro tip: the dry season is your best bet for volcano hikes and temple visits.
Why Visit Java Island?
Why Java? Because it’s the soul of Indonesia. It’s where ancient kingdoms thrived, colonial powers squabbled, and now modern life buzzes alongside age-old traditions.
Cultural Depth: Want to watch shadow puppets (wayang kulit) while listening to hypnotic gamelan music? Yogyakarta’s got you. Craving to learn batik-making from artisans whose hands weave history into every pattern? Java’s your canvas.
Natural Beauty: Picture yourself standing on the rim of Mount Bromo at dawn, the volcano puffing gently like it’s having its morning coffee. Or staring into the eerie blue flames of Ijen Crater, thinking, “Is this even real?” Spoiler: it is.
Urban Energy Meets Rural Charm: One minute, you’re dodging motorbikes in Jakarta, the next you’re sipping tea in a tranquil plantation in Bandung. Java gives you both, and does it unapologetically.
Affordability: Luxury doesn’t need to break the bank here. Delicious street food for $1, charming homestays, and even guided tours that won’t empty your wallet. Your money stretches further than a Balinese sarong at a beach market.
Top Attractions on Java Island
a. Historical & Cultural Landmarks
• Borobudur Temple: Imagine a massive stone structure shaped like a giant mandala, carved with 2,672 relief panels and 504 Buddha statues. Built in the 9th century, it’s the world’s largest Buddhist temple. Go at sunrise. Trust me. Watching the mist lift over the surrounding jungles is pure magic.
• Prambanan Temple: A short drive from Borobudur, Prambanan is Java’s grand Hindu temple complex. Its spires reach for the sky like stone fingers, each one adorned with intricate carvings that tell ancient tales of gods and demons. Bonus: it lights up beautifully at night.
• Kraton Yogyakarta: Not just a palace, the palace. It’s a living, breathing cultural hub where the Sultan’s family still resides. Don’t miss the traditional Javanese dance performances here; they’re hypnotic in the best way.
b. Natural Wonders
• Mount Bromo: This one’s legendary. Set your alarm for 3 AM (yes, really) and hike up for sunrise. The view? A Martian-like landscape with plumes of smoke rising from Bromo’s crater, bathed in golden light. Worth every lost minute of sleep.
• Ijen Crater: Ever seen blue fire? No? Head to Ijen. This active volcano spews electric-blue flames at night, thanks to ignited sulfuric gases. It’s surreal, slightly eerie, and completely unforgettable.
• Dieng Plateau: High up in Central Java, Dieng feels like another planet, with steaming geothermal vents, colorful sulfur lakes, and ancient temples scattered across misty fields.
c. Vibrant Cities
• Jakarta: Indonesia’s capital is chaotic, noisy, and fascinating. It’s a place where skyscrapers meet street food stalls, and luxury malls stand next to traditional markets. Dive into Kota Tua (Old Town) for colonial architecture and hip cafés.
• Bandung: Known as the “Paris of Java” (yes, really), Bandung offers cool mountain air, chic boutiques, and art deco architecture. Plus, the food scene is a dream.
• Yogyakarta (Jogja): The cultural heart of Java. Artists, musicians, and poets thrive here. It’s laid-back yet buzzing with creativity, think batik workshops, street art, and vibrant markets.
Hidden Gems and Off-the-Beaten-Path Destinations
• Karimunjawa Islands: Want a tropical paradise minus the Bali crowds? Hop over to Karimunjawa, an archipelago of 27 islands with turquoise waters, white sandy beaches, and epic snorkeling spots.
• Pangandaran: A beach town that’s somehow flown under the tourist radar. Great for surfing, exploring caves, and enjoying fresh seafood without fighting for a sunbed.
• Green Canyon (Cukang Taneuh): Think of it as Indonesia’s answer to the Grand Canyon. Except it’s green, lush, and perfect for river tubing through caves and waterfalls.
Java Island Travel Itineraries
7-Day Cultural & Nature Tour
• Day 1-2: Jakarta – Explore Kota Tua, National Monument, street food tours.
• Day 3-4: Yogyakarta – Borobudur, Prambanan, batik workshops.
• Day 5: Dieng Plateau – Quick escape to cooler, mystical highlands.
• Day 6-7: Mount Bromo – Sunrise trek, then chill in Surabaya before heading home.
Adventure Seeker’s Itinerary
• Volcano hop: Mount Bromo → Ijen Crater → Semeru (Java’s highest peak).
• Add in cave tubing in Goa Pindul and river rafting in Progo River.
• Finish with beach camping at Karimunjawa. Your muscles will thank you, eventually.
Family-Friendly Route
• Jakarta’s Ancol Dreamland (theme parks, aquarium, beaches).
• Yogyakarta’s Taman Sari Water Castle and easy walks around Borobudur.
• Relaxing days in Bandung with its cool weather and family-friendly attractions.
Food & Culinary Delights
Java isn’t just a feast for the eyes, it’s one for the taste buds too.
• Nasi Gudeg: A Yogyakarta specialty made from young jackfruit stewed in coconut milk. Sweet, savory, and served with rice, boiled eggs, and spicy sambal.
• Sate Ayam: Grilled chicken skewers served with rich, nutty peanut sauce. Simple. Addictive.
• Gado-Gado: Think of it as Indonesia’s answer to a salad, steamed vegetables, boiled eggs, tofu, and tempeh, smothered in creamy peanut dressing.
• Bakso: Bouncy meatballs served in a savory broth. President Obama even gave it a shout-out (true story, he grew up in Jakarta for a bit).
Street food is everywhere. Don’t be afraid to eat where the locals eat. If there’s a line, it’s probably worth the wait.
Practical Travel Tips for Java Island
• Getting There: Major international airports in Jakarta (CGK), Surabaya (SUB), and Yogyakarta (YIA). Domestic flights are cheap and frequent.
• Getting Around: Java’s train system is surprisingly good, comfortable, affordable, and scenic. For city travel, grab an ojek (motorbike taxi) via apps like Gojek or Grab.
• Safety Tips: Keep an eye on your belongings, especially in crowded areas. Dress modestly when visiting temples. Learn a few basic phrases in Bahasa goes a long way.
• Budget: Java is budget-friendly. Expect to spend around $30-50/day comfortably, including food, accommodation, and transport. Street food costs $1-3, local transport even less.
Java is more than a destination; it’s an experience woven with history, nature, and culture at every turn. Whether you’re sipping tea on a misty plateau, hiking a volcano under a sky full of stars, or bargaining in a bustling market, Java will surprise you. Every single time.
Sustainable Travel in Java: How to Explore Responsibly
Java’s beauty is breathtaking, but with millions of visitors each year, sustainable travel isn’t just a trend. It’s a necessity. Here’s how you can leave a positive impact while exploring.
• Support Local Businesses: Choose family-run guesthouses, local guides, and traditional warungs (small eateries) instead of big chains. It keeps money in the community and gives you a more authentic experience.
• Eco-Friendly Transport: Java’s train system is not only scenic but also environmentally friendly. For short distances, opt for walking, cycling, or electric scooters available in some cities.
• Reduce Plastic Waste: Carry a reusable water bottle. Many cafes offer refill stations, and it saves tons of single-use plastic.
• Respect Natural Sites: Don’t stray off marked trails when hiking volcanoes like Bromo or Ijen. It helps protect fragile ecosystems. Plus, no one wants to be that tourist.
• Cultural Sensitivity: Learn a few phrases in Bahasa Indonesia, dress modestly when visiting religious sites, and always ask before taking photos of people.
Traveling sustainably in Java isn’t about perfection, it’s about small choices that add up.
Live Like a Local: Authentic Experiences in Java
Want to ditch the tourist trail for a day? Here’s how to get under Java’s skin:
• Join a Batik Workshop in Yogyakarta: Create your batik cloth using traditional wax-resist dyeing techniques. Not only do you learn the art, but you also get a unique souvenir.
• Stay in a Javanese Homestay: Skip the hotels and spend a night with a local family. Experience daily life, home-cooked meals, and authentic hospitality.
• Morning Market Adventures: Visit a pasar pagi (morning market) like Pasar Beringharjo in Yogyakarta. It’s chaotic, colorful, and full of life. Perfect for tasting local snacks and practicing your bargaining skills.
• Farming in the Rice Fields: In places like Magelang, you can spend a day with farmers, planting rice, harvesting crops, or just enjoying a simple meal in the fields.
• Coffee Plantation Tours in Bandung: Learn how Java (yes, that Java) became synonymous with coffee. From bean to cup, it’s a journey worth sipping.
These experiences go beyond sightseeing. They connect you with the heart of Java, the people, their stories, and their way of life.
Conclusion
Java isn’t a place you just visit. It’s a place that sticks with you, like the aroma of freshly brewed coffee or the lingering warmth after a perfect sunrise. It’s an island where contradictions live side by side: ancient temples shadowed by modern skyscrapers, serene rice fields a stone’s throw from chaotic city streets, and timeless traditions pulsing through contemporary culture.
Whether you came for the volcanic landscapes, the rich history, or just to say you’ve stood where kingdoms once rose and fell, Java delivers more than you expect. It’s vibrant. It’s unpredictable. Sometimes it’s overwhelming. But it’s never, ever boring. So, when someone asks, “Why Java?”, you’ll have a hundred stories to tell. And maybe, just maybe, you’ll find yourself planning your return before you’ve even left.